Kynthia, crafted by the talented Akifatype Studio, is a captivating calligraphy font that exudes elegance and grace. Its semi-bold weight adds a touch of modernity to its traditional brushstroke style.

Ideal for wedding invitations, gourmet menus, and luxury branding projects, Kynthia effortlessly captures attention with its fluid lines and intricate details. This versatile font typeface is equally suited for bold headlines or delicate script text, making it a must-have in any designer's toolkit.
